服务器迁移后,Silverstripe 4在尝试上载文件时抛出错误

服务器迁移后,Silverstripe 4在尝试上载文件时抛出错误,silverstripe,silverstripe-4,Silverstripe,Silverstripe 4,我刚刚将一个SS4站点迁移到一个新服务器。现在,当我试图上传一张图片时,我得到了下面的信息。下面是我看到的错误: 尽管我刚刚通过管理员身份验证,但这种情况仍在发生。我认为这是文件系统的权限问题,但进一步研究后,情况似乎并非如此 文件看起来确实上传了,但是预览没有创建,也没有显示在预览区域中。我可以保存资产,但不能使用右下角的“保存”和“发布”按钮,我必须使用批量操作来发布文件。完成此操作后,将显示预览 我在控制台中收到/已收到以下错误: Uncaught (in promise) SyntaxE

我刚刚将一个SS4站点迁移到一个新服务器。现在,当我试图上传一张图片时,我得到了下面的信息。下面是我看到的错误:

尽管我刚刚通过管理员身份验证,但这种情况仍在发生。我认为这是文件系统的权限问题,但进一步研究后,情况似乎并非如此

文件看起来确实上传了,但是预览没有创建,也没有显示在预览区域中。我可以保存资产,但不能使用右下角的“保存”和“发布”按钮,我必须使用批量操作来发布文件。完成此操作后,将显示预览

我在控制台中收到/已收到以下错误:

Uncaught (in promise) SyntaxError: Unexpected token < in JSON at position 0

(async)http://example.com/admin/assets/show/295/edit/307 400 (Bad Request)

GET http://example.com/admin/assets/show/295/edit/307 400 (Bad Request)
Uncaught(在promise中)语法错误:JSON中位置0处出现意外标记<
(异步)http://example.com/admin/assets/show/295/edit/307 400(错误请求)
得到http://example.com/admin/assets/show/295/edit/307 400(错误请求)

有没有人有这方面的经验或文档?不确定如何诊断/修复此问题

如果您在“网络请求”选项卡上查看失败的表单提交请求,您可以查看响应,它可能是包含堆栈跟踪的HTML。这应该告诉你出了什么问题。嗨@RobbieAverill,我用更多的信息更新了我的问题。您是否有更多关于如何诊断和修复的想法?
Uncaught (in promise) SyntaxError: Unexpected token < in JSON at position 0

(async)http://example.com/admin/assets/show/295/edit/307 400 (Bad Request)

GET http://example.com/admin/assets/show/295/edit/307 400 (Bad Request)